- The distance between Huambo, Angola and Mafraq, Jordan is approximately 5,475 km or 3,402 mi.
- To reach Huambo in this distance one would set out from Mafraq bearing 206.8° or SS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Huambo bearing 203° or SSW .
- Huambo has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b) whereas Mafraq has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k).
- Huambo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Mafraq is in or near the subtropical desert scrub biome.
- The average temperature is 2.4 °C (4.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 13 °C (23.4°F) less in Huambo.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1249 mm (49.2 in) more which is equivalent to 1249 l/m² (30.65 US gal/ft²) or 12,490,000 l/ha (1,335,264 US gal/ac) more. About 9 1/3 as much.
- There are 1034 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Huambo. In whichever way circa 2h 49' less per day or about 2/3 as many.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.3° higher in Huambo than in Mafraq.
- Relative humidity levels are 12.3%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 2°C (3.6°F) lower.
